Prejudice, stereotypes, and discrimination are interconnected concepts that involve negative attitudes and actions towards individuals based on their group membership.


Explanation:

Prejudice is defined as negative attitudes and feelings towards individuals based solely on their membership in a particular group. This unjustifiable negative attitude is often manifested through stereotypes which are beliefs about the characteristics of specific groups and their members. When acted upon, prejudice can lead to discrimination, which involves negative actions towards individuals based on their group membership.
